The Fundamentals of Surety Contract Bonds
Surety Contract bonds are necessary for building tasks, offering a warranty that the specialist will satisfy their obligations to the project owner. These bonds function as a form of monetary protection for the project proprietor, ensuring that they'll be made up if the specialist fails to finish the task or stops working to meet the agreed-upon terms.
When a service provider gets a guaranty bond, they're basically participating in a three-party agreement with the job owner and the surety business. The guaranty business serves as a guarantor, promising to meet the contractor's commitments if they're incapable to do so. This offers the job owner peace of mind, knowing that they'll not suffer monetary loss if the service provider doesn't fulfill their obligations.
Secret Advantages of Surety Contract Bonds
One significant advantage of Surety Contract bonds is the guarantee they give to job owners that their investment is safeguarded. With Surety Contract bonds, you can anticipate the adhering to benefits:
- ** Financial security **: Surety Contract bonds make certain that in case of service provider default or non-performance, the job owner will be compensated for any financial losses incurred.
- ** Quality assurance **: Surety Contract bonds need specialists to stick to strict Performance requirements, guaranteeing that the job will be completed to the defined quality and specs.
- ** Threat mitigation **: By calling for Surety Contract bonds, job owners can transfer the risk of service provider default or non-performance to the guaranty company, minimizing their very own financial and lawful responsibilities.
These advantages not only offer assurance to task proprietors, but also aid to develop a much more transparent and reliable construction procedure.
Exactly How to Acquire Surety Contract Bonds
To safeguard Surety Contract bonds for your building and construction job, you'll need to comply with an uncomplicated application procedure.
The very first step is to find a trustworthy guaranty bond firm that focuses on building bonds. As soon as you have actually identified an ideal business, you'll require to complete an application form that includes information regarding your task, such as the extent of work, approximated Contract worth, and project timeline. You might likewise be needed to offer economic declarations and references.
After sending your application, the surety bond firm will certainly examine your project's risks and assess your monetary stability. If accepted, you'll obtain a quote for the bond costs.
